Creamy Beef and Shells Yield: 4 servings Prep time: 15 minutes Cook time: 25 minutes Total time: 40 minutes Ingredients: 8 ounces medium pasta shells 1 tablespoon olive oil 1 pound ground beef 1/2 medium sweet onion, diced 2 cloves garlic, minced 1 1/2 teaspoons Italian seasoning 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our 2 cups beef stock 1 (15-ounce) can tomato sauce 3/4 cup heavy cream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ste 6 ounces shredded extra-sharp cheddar cheese, about 1 1/2 cups Directions: In a large pot of boiling salted water, cook pasta according to package instructions; drain well.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ium high heat. Add ground beef and cook until browned, about 3-5 minutes, making sure to crumble the beef as it cooks; drain excess fat. Set aside. Add onion to the skillet, and cook, stirring frequently, until translucent, about 2-3 minutes. Stir in garlic and Italian seasoning until fragrant, about 1 minute. Whisk in flour until lightly browned, about 1 minute. Gradually whisk in beef stock and tomato sauce. Bring to a boil; reduce heat and simmer, stirring occasionally, until reduced and slightly thickened, about 6-8 minutes. Stir in pasta, beef and heavy cream until heated through, about 1-2 minutes; season with salt and pepper, to taste. Stir in cheese until melted, about 2 minutes. Serve immediately.
